High severity cases can be given low Priority
Ex: Few applications may have been developed 80% and 20%
may be missing which is high severity, but test engineer
may cnsider it as low priority as he is already knows that
the application will anyways be developed.
Low Severity cases can be given high priority
Ex: For an application where in the client needs to check
how is it progressing, low severity cases like spellings,
grammar are given high priority and rectified.
